Property summary
This exceptional multifamily investment property, located at 526 Western Avenue in Lynn, Massachusetts, presents a compelling value-add opportunity. The four-story brick building encompasses 17,688 square feet of net rentable space, distributed across sixteen units – eleven three-bedroom/one-bathroom and five two-bedroom/one-bathroom apartments. Situated on a 0.13-acre lot, this fee-simple property boasts a strong 7.82% cap rate and a substantial net operating income (NOI) of $312,939, with an asking price of $4,000,000 ($250,000 per unit and $226 per square foot). Built in 1910, the property benefits from its location in a densely populated residential neighborhood near downtown Lynn, offering convenient access to public transportation, including the Central Square commuter rail station (0.8 miles) providing service to Boston's North Station. The property is also within walking distance of numerous amenities, including restaurants, shops, and the new Mosaic mixed-use development.
